Cholula y Puebla Day Tour from Mexico City
ITINERARY
Our day trip begins in the city of Puebla, a UNESCO world heritage site which is famous for its Talavera ceramics, cuisine, crafts and textiles. Here many people from the towns still speak Náhuatl. You will visit the famous chapel of Rosario's Virgin and the historic center of the city. You will visit the Cathedral, Palafoxiana library , Central Square and other colonial places.
Later we will drive toward Cholula and along the ride you can see the two volcanoes; Popocatepetl and Iztlaccihuatl. The archaeological site of Cholula is one of the most antique sites in Mesoamerica and known by its big pyramid and sanctuary dedicated to the Virgin. This represents the end of the god of the Indians and the beginning of evangelization. Cholula also is famous because it has 365 churches, one for each day of the year.
Later we will return to our hotels in México for dinner relaxation.
